What Is Wart?

A wart is a small, rough skin growth caused by the human papillomavirus (HPV). It exists because the virus triggers rapid cell division in the top skin layer. Warts are typically painless, though pressure on them can cause discomfort.

Definition of Wart

A wart is a benign epithelial tumor induced by infection with specific strains of HPV, characterized by hyperkeratosis and a rough, papillary surface. These growths arise from viral DNA replication in keratinocytes, leading to localized thickening of the stratum corneum and a distinct clinical appearance.

Common Examples of Wart

  • Common wart – a rough, dome-shaped growth typically found on fingers, hands, and knees, caused by HPV types 2 and 4.
  • Plantar wart – a hard, flat growth on the sole that grows inward, often painful, caused by HPV type 1.
  • Flat wart – a small, smooth, slightly raised bump appearing in clusters on the face, neck, or legs, caused by HPV types 3 and 10.
  • Filiform wart – a long, thin, thread-like growth on the eyelids, neck, or lips, caused by HPV types 1, 2, 4, and 27.
  • Periungual wart – a wart located around or under the toenails and fingernails, which can disrupt nail growth, caused by HPV types 1, 2, and 4.
  • Genital wart – a soft, moist growth on the genital or anal area, sexually transmitted, caused by HPV types 6 and 11.
  • Mosaic wart – a cluster of multiple plantar warts that merge into a larger, irregular plaque on the foot, caused by HPV type 2.
  • Palmar wart – a wart on the palm of the hand, often flat and surrounded by thickened skin, caused by HPV types 1 and 2.
  • Juvenile wart – a flat wart occurring mainly in children and adolescents, often on the face, caused by HPV types 3 and 10.
  • Digitate wart – a wart with finger-like projections extending outward, commonly found on the scalp or face, caused by HPV types 2 and 4.

What Is Mole?

A mole is a common skin growth made of clustered pigment cells called melanocytes. Moles form when these cells grow in a cluster instead of spreading evenly. Most moles appear during childhood and can change or fade over time.

Definition of Mole

A mole, medically termed a melanocytic nevus, is a benign neoplasm originating from melanocytes. These pigment-producing cells accumulate at the epidermal-dermal junction or within the dermis. Moles are typically round, pigmented macules or papules with well-defined borders, presenting as tan, brown, or black lesions.

Common Examples of Mole

  • Junctional nevus - A flat, dark brown mole located entirely within the epidermis, common in childhood.
  • Compound nevus - A raised mole with pigmented cells in both epidermis and dermis, often dome-shaped.
  • Intradermal nevus - A flesh-colored or lightly pigmented dome that sits fully within the dermis, typical in adults.
  • Congenital nevus - A mole present at birth, ranging from small to giant, with slightly higher melanoma risk.
  • Acquired nevus - A mole that develops after birth, usually appearing during childhood or early adulthood.
  • Atypical nevus - A mole with irregular borders, mixed colors, and larger size, also called a dysplastic nevus.
  • Halo nevus - A mole surrounded by a depigmented white ring, often signaling an immune system response.
  • Spitz nevus - A pink or red raised mole seen mainly in children, which can mimic melanoma microscopically.
  • Blue nevus - A blue-gray mole caused by deep pigment deposits, typically found on the buttocks or hands.
  • Miescher nevus - A thick, dome-shaped mole on the face or neck, composed of dermal melanocytes.

Common Misconceptions About Wart and Mole

Common MythThe Reality
Warts have roots that extend deep into the skin.Warts grow in the top skin layer only; their base is flat, not root-like.
Moles always appear at birth and never change.Moles often appear during childhood or teens and can darken or fade over time.
Cutting a wart off makes it go away permanently.Cutting a wart leaves viral cells behind, so the wart typically regrows quickly.
All moles are cancerous and must be removed immediately.Most moles are benign; only atypical or changing moles require a dermatologist's evaluation.
Warts are caused by touching frogs or toads.Warts come from human papillomavirus (HPV), never from frogs or toads.
A mole with hair is always dangerous.Hair in a mole usually indicates a benign growth; cancer risk depends on shape and change.
Warts are highly contagious through any casual contact.Warts spread through broken skin or shared surfaces, not through brief touching of intact skin.
Moles only appear on sun-exposed areas like the face.Moles develop anywhere on the body, including palms, soles, and under nails.
Duct tape cures every wart within two weeks.Duct tape may help some warts, but many require months of treatment or professional removal.
Dark moles are automatically melanoma.Dark color alone does not mean cancer; asymmetry, border, and change matter more.
Warts are a sign of poor personal hygiene.Warts infect people regardless of cleanliness; hygiene does not prevent HPV transmission.
Moles grow larger when you scratch or pick them.Scratching a mole does not enlarge it, but it can cause bleeding, infection, or irritation.
Freezing a wart at home works exactly like a doctor's treatment.Home freezing kits are milder and often fail on larger or thicker warts.
Moles disappear if you apply lemon juice or garlic.No home remedy removes a mole; acids or herbs only irritate skin without eliminating the mole.
Warts on the feet are the same as corns.Warts are viral growths with tiny black dots; corns are thick skin from pressure, not viruses.
Raised moles are more dangerous than flat moles.Elevation does not determine cancer risk; flat moles can also become melanoma.
Warts always hurt when you press on them.Many warts are painless; plantar warts hurt with side pressure, but others feel nothing.
Moles multiply rapidly after sun exposure.Sun can darken existing moles, but it does not cause new moles to multiply rapidly.
One wart treatment works for every type of wart.Common, plantar, flat, and genital warts each require different treatments and approaches.
Moles with irregular borders are always melanoma.Irregular borders signal a need for biopsy, but many atypical moles remain benign.
Warts have seeds that you can see inside them.Dark dots in a wart are clotted blood vessels, not seeds or roots.
Children get more moles than adults do.Adults accumulate more moles over time; children typically have fewer total moles.
Covering a wart with tape stops it from spreading.Tape may reduce friction but does not kill HPV, so the wart virus can still spread.
Moles itch because they are turning cancerous.Itching can occur in benign moles from friction or dryness, not only from malignancy.
Warts are harmless and never need any treatment.Warts can spread, become painful, or persist for years; some require medical removal.
Black moles are always more dangerous than brown moles.Color alone is unreliable; a mole's pattern, evolution, and symmetry determine risk.
Warts only affect children and teenagers.Warts affect all ages; adults get them especially when immunity drops or skin is damaged.
Moles can turn into warts if you irritate them.Moles are pigment cells and warts are viral; one can never transform into the other.
Picking a wart off with fingernails removes it for good.Picking a wart leaves infected tissue behind and often spreads HPV to nearby skin.
Moles are always symmetrical and round.Many benign moles are oval or irregular; symmetry is just one factor in cancer screening.
